Chinaunix首页 | 论坛 | 博客
  • 博客访问: 1244049
  • 博文数量: 116
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 1168
  • 用 户 组: 普通用户
  • 注册时间: 2016-08-23 11:14
文章分类

全部博文(116)

文章存档

2020年(10)

2019年(8)

2018年(28)

2017年(7)

2016年(63)

我的朋友

分类: LINUX

2019-11-06 18:55:06

原文链接:在windows下写linux代码直接编译
原文作者:linux_c_coding_man

   大多数人都习惯于在windows下用source insight编辑代码,然后用xftp拷贝到linux下进行编译,如果有小的改动,就直接在linux下用vim进行编辑修改。至于为什么是vim,工作这么多年,还没有一家公司的服务器是带界面的,可以安装使用ide的。
稍微进阶一点的办法,就是实现linux和windows文件夹共享,我们在windows上直接对着共享文件夹内的代码进行编辑,然后就在linux下进行执行make编译就行了,不需要再xftp拷贝。方法有两个:
1.在linux下安装samba,然后配置,最后在windows上添加一个网络位置的方式来实现linux和windows文件夹共享。
2.在windows上安装SftpDrive,然后ssh到linux下指定一个目录映射到windows下驱动器。
    这里重点说方法2,最方便好用,因为我们公司的linux服务器管理严格,不让安装samba,而且只开放了ssh端口供我们开发使用,那么SftpDrive是最合适的了。

   输入服务器地址,端口,用户名,密码,然后在Directory选择linux下要映射的代码目录,在Drive Letter选择映射到windows下的驱动器盘符,点击connect

   SftpDrive百度网盘分享链接:https://pan.baidu.com/s/1nwfku1N 密码:52b3

2019.2.28更新
   SftpDrive在win10机器上用不了,我找了好久找到一个可以用的简单方便,SFTP Net Drive,附上下载链接https://www.nsoftware.com/sftp/drive/

   选择Advanced Settings,再选择Drive,只需要注意Drive Type和Specified folder就好了

   一般都是选择网络映射,然后指定映射目录/home。详细的配置说明我们可以看官网的介绍http://cdn.nsoftware.com/help/NDC/app/pg_advancedsettings.htm
阅读(226) | 评论(0) | 转发(0) |
0

上一篇:Linux shell

下一篇:grep 正则表达式

给主人留下些什么吧!~~